Instructions
Cover a baking sheet with aluminum foil, and coat foil with cooking spray. Arrange tomato slices in a single layer on baking sheet.
Drizzle oil over tomatoes.
Sprinkle with thyme, 1/4 teaspoon salt, and garlic.
Bake at 400 for 35 minutes or until tomatoes start to dry out.
Cook pasta according to package directions, omitting salt and fat.
Place flour in a large Dutch oven; gradually add milk, stirring with a whisk until blended. Cook over medium heat 8 minutes or until thick and bubbly, stirring constantly with a whisk.
Add cheddar, fontina, remaining 1/2 teaspoon salt, and pepper, stirring until cheese melts.
Remove from heat. Stir in tomatoes and pasta. Spoon into a 13 x 9inch baking dish coated with cooking spray.
Combine grated Parmesan cheese and breadcrumbs; sprinkle over pasta mixture.
Bake at 400 for 25 minutes or until bubbly.
For baby: Omit black pepper.
Serve spoonfuls in a small bowl.
Cut the tomatoes and macaroni, if needed, into bite-sized pieces.
